John 4:35

Scripture

John 4:35

Don’t you have a saying, ‘It’s still four months until harvest’? I tell you, open your eyes and look at the fields! They are ripe for harvest.

Reflect

Jesus tells His disciples, “Open your eyes… the fields are ripe for harvest.” They thought it was an ordinary moment. Jesus saw a kingdom moment.

Resurrection people learn to see differently. While the world sees hopelessness, we see potential. While others see strangers, we see people loved by God. While others say, “Maybe later,” resurrection people say, “Now is the time.”

The harvest is not about pressure. It’s about participation in what God is already doing.

Celebratory Activity

Pray this short prayer: “Lord, open my eyes to someone I can love today.” Then pay attention.

Prayer

Lord of the harvest, open my eyes to what You see. Let me notice, and join, where You are already at work. Amen.
